Transaction 775a64c6c0337a5a06563195687c873c1b139c14c5a7059492c612d86db667e5

1 Input
2 Outputs
  • 775a64c6c0337a5a06563195687c873c1b139c14c5a7059492c612d86db667e5:0
  • value  488189
    address  3KYZPoVa2Ct9rfQbDYcNr9H6tqcwp2ESrD
  • 775a64c6c0337a5a06563195687c873c1b139c14c5a7059492c612d86db667e5:1
  • value  499420
    address  17JAFe34ToRN7F4JRm1DuYiSd3ZNSrJN4u